Due to the fact there was at first no effortless strategy for purifying the steel created, it was necessary for the Uncooked product, the alumina, to get purified alternatively. The Bayer course of action dissolved the impure alumina, typically in the shape of bauxite, in molten sodium hydroxide. Because aluminium is amphoteric, as described above, it dissolved though the iron and titanium hydroxides within the impurities did not. The purified alumina could then be recovered from your NaOH, and Employed in the Hall-Héroult system.

Aluminium ought to displace hydrogen from water thanks to its positive oxidation potential, but would not Commonly achieve this due to safety by a surface layer of oxide. This oxide has a similar density as being the metallic aluminium, so it does not crack or wrinkle when it truly is fashioned, a lucky matter. A bit HCl or NaOH that dissolves the oxide will permit the evolution of hydrogen. Aluminium pots and pans really should not be utilised with acidic or strongly alkaline foods, which will dissolve the protective layer and permit the metallic being attacked. Aluminium is attacked by hydrochloric acid, although not by oxidizing acids like nitric. Aluminium tank vehicles are even used to transport nitric acid.

Alums are way more soluble in scorching drinking water than in cold, so that crystals are quickly developed from an answer that is now supersaturated by cooling. In amazing h2o, KAl alum is less soluble than KFe, so it is extremely simple to remove smaller quantities of Fe ion by fractional crystallization. This capacity to get incredibly pure alum may be very practical in dyeing, in which a little Fe ion spoils the colour.
